Report: Pacers adding ex-NBA big man Foster to Bjorkgren's staff

The Indiana Pacers are bringing on former NBA player Greg Foster as an assistant on first-time head coach Nate Bjorkgren's coaching staff, The New York Times' Marc Stein reports.

As a backup big man, Foster played for nine teams from 1990-03, most predominantly the Utah Jazz. He was also a member of the Los Angeles Lakers' title-winning team in 2000-01.

The 52-year-old served on Lloyd Pierce's Atlanta Hawks staff for the past two seasons after stints with the Milwaukee Bucks and Philadelphia 76ers.
